Why governance determines quote-to-revenue scalability
Many ERP initiatives fail to scale quote-to-revenue not because the platform lacks capability, but because governance decisions are deferred until exceptions appear. Sales wants speed, finance wants control, operations wants standardization and IT wants maintainability. Without a governance model, each function optimizes locally. The result is inconsistent product catalogs, unmanaged discounting, duplicate customer records, brittle integrations and manual billing workarounds. Governance creates a shared framework for balancing commercial agility with financial integrity.
In practical terms, governance should define approval authorities, design principles, release controls, data ownership, integration standards, security responsibilities and escalation paths. It should also establish measurable business outcomes such as quote cycle time, order accuracy, billing timeliness, renewal readiness and dispute reduction. These are not just operational metrics; they are indicators of revenue quality. For CIOs and transformation leaders, this is where ERP modernization becomes a business performance program rather than a software deployment.
What to assess before selecting the target operating model
Discovery and assessment should begin with the commercial operating model, not the application menu. The implementation team needs to understand how products are packaged, how pricing is approved, how contracts are structured, how subscriptions are amended, how invoices are triggered and how exceptions are resolved. In SaaS businesses, quote-to-revenue often includes usage-based elements, partner channels, regional tax complexity, service bundles and renewal workflows that cut across departments. These realities shape the ERP design far more than generic best practices.
Business process analysis should map the current state from opportunity through cash collection and renewal. Gap analysis should then compare current capabilities with the desired future state, identifying where Odoo standard functionality is sufficient, where process redesign is preferable and where extensions may be justified. This is also the stage to assess multi-company requirements, shared services models, intercompany billing, multi-currency needs and, where relevant, multi-warehouse implications for hardware bundles, spare parts or fulfillment-linked subscriptions.
| Assessment domain | Key business questions | Governance implication |
|---|---|---|
| Commercial model | How are products, subscriptions, services and discounts governed? | Defines approval workflows, catalog ownership and pricing controls |
| Finance operations | When is billing triggered and how are exceptions handled? | Shapes accounting design, invoice controls and reconciliation rules |
| Customer data | Who owns account, contract and billing master data? | Establishes stewardship, validation and change approval |
| Integration landscape | Which systems remain authoritative for CRM, tax, support or analytics? | Determines API-first architecture and interface governance |
| Cloud operations | What uptime, recovery and monitoring expectations exist? | Informs deployment model, observability and business continuity planning |
How to design the solution architecture without overengineering
Solution architecture for quote-to-revenue should prioritize control points, data integrity and extensibility. In Odoo, the core application set often includes CRM for pipeline governance, Sales for quotations and order conversion, Subscription where recurring billing is central, Accounting for invoicing and financial control, Documents and Knowledge for contract and policy management, and Helpdesk when customer support events influence renewals or service credits. Spreadsheet and analytics views can support executive reporting when designed around decision-making rather than raw data exposure.
Functional design should define the lifecycle of products, price books, contracts, amendments, billing schedules, collections triggers and renewal motions. Technical design should then specify how those business objects are represented, integrated and secured. An API-first architecture is usually the right choice when external systems such as tax engines, payment gateways, CPQ tools, identity providers, data warehouses or customer portals remain part of the landscape. APIs reduce coupling, improve auditability and support phased modernization.
Cloud deployment strategy matters because governance does not end at application design. Enterprise teams should decide early whether they need managed environments with stronger control over release cadence, monitoring, observability and security operations. Where scale, partner delivery and operational accountability are priorities, managed cloud services can provide a more disciplined foundation than ad hoc hosting. Technologies such as Kubernetes, Docker, PostgreSQL and Redis are relevant only insofar as they support resilience, performance isolation, backup strategy and enterprise scalability. They should remain implementation concerns governed by service objectives, not marketing labels.
Where configuration should end and customization should begin
A common governance failure is allowing customization to substitute for unresolved business decisions. Configuration strategy should therefore be anchored in standard process adoption wherever it does not compromise competitive differentiation or regulatory obligations. In quote-to-revenue, many issues that appear to require custom code are actually policy questions: discount authority, contract versioning, invoice timing, approval routing or customer hierarchy rules. Resolve the policy first, then configure the platform.
Customization strategy should be reserved for capabilities that create measurable business value and cannot be addressed through standard Odoo features, approved extensions or process redesign. OCA module evaluation can be appropriate when a mature community module addresses a specific need, but governance should review maintainability, version compatibility, security posture, documentation quality and long-term ownership. The same review should apply to Odoo Studio artifacts, which can accelerate delivery but still require lifecycle control, testing discipline and architectural oversight.
- Prefer standard Odoo behavior for core sales, subscription and accounting flows unless a documented business case supports deviation.
- Use OCA modules only after functional fit, technical quality, upgrade impact and support ownership are reviewed.
- Treat Studio changes as governed assets with naming standards, testing requirements and release approval.
- Reject customizations that replicate legacy inefficiency or create hidden dependencies across finance and sales operations.
How to govern integrations, data migration and master data quality
Quote-to-revenue programs often fail at the boundaries between systems. Integration strategy should identify systems of record for customer accounts, opportunities, contracts, invoices, payments, support entitlements and analytics. API-first architecture is especially valuable here because it allows each domain to evolve with clearer ownership and lower risk than file-based or database-level coupling. Integration governance should define payload standards, error handling, retry logic, reconciliation controls, version management and monitoring responsibilities.
Data migration strategy should focus on business readiness, not just technical extraction. Historical data should be classified by operational necessity, reporting value and compliance relevance. Not every legacy quote, invoice or contract amendment belongs in the new ERP. The migration plan should define cutover scope, cleansing rules, validation checkpoints and rollback criteria. Master data governance is critical because quote-to-revenue quality depends on trusted customer, product, pricing, tax and contract data. Ownership should be explicit, with stewardship roles across sales operations, finance and IT.
| Data domain | Primary owner | Governance focus |
|---|---|---|
| Customer and account master | Sales operations with finance oversight | Deduplication, legal entity accuracy, billing hierarchy and credit controls |
| Product and subscription catalog | Product management with finance validation | SKU governance, pricing logic, revenue mapping and retirement rules |
| Contract and billing terms | Finance and legal operations | Standard clauses, amendment controls and invoice trigger consistency |
| Reference and integration data | Enterprise architecture and application owners | API mappings, code sets, version control and reconciliation |
What testing and security controls are required before go-live
Testing should be structured around business risk. User Acceptance Testing must validate end-to-end scenarios such as quote approval, subscription activation, proration, invoice generation, payment application, credit note handling, renewal and cancellation. UAT should be led by business process owners, not only by the project team, because governance depends on operational acceptance of controls and exceptions. Performance testing is essential when pricing logic, integrations or billing runs could create bottlenecks at period close or renewal peaks.
Security testing should verify role design, segregation of duties, approval integrity, audit trail completeness and integration security. Identity and Access Management is directly relevant in SaaS ERP because quote-to-revenue spans sensitive commercial and financial data. Access should be role-based, least-privilege and aligned to company structure, especially in multi-company deployments. Compliance expectations vary by industry and geography, but governance should always include logging, backup validation, recovery testing and documented incident response procedures.
How to prepare the organization for adoption, cutover and hypercare
Training strategy should be role-based and scenario-driven. Sales teams need confidence in quoting and approvals, finance teams need confidence in billing and exception handling, and support or customer success teams need visibility into contract and entitlement status where relevant. Knowledge transfer should include not only system steps but also policy rationale, because governance breaks down when users do not understand why controls exist.
Organizational change management should address process ownership, decision rights and performance expectations. In many SaaS organizations, quote-to-revenue exposes long-standing ambiguity between sales, finance and operations. The ERP program is an opportunity to formalize accountability. Go-live planning should include cutover sequencing, communication plans, command center roles, issue triage, fallback decisions and executive checkpoints. Hypercare support should be time-bound but intensive, with daily review of transaction quality, integration failures, user adoption issues and financial reconciliation.
- Establish an executive steering cadence with clear decisions on scope, policy exceptions and readiness gates.
- Run cutover rehearsals that include data loads, integration activation, billing validation and support escalation paths.
- Define hypercare metrics such as quote conversion accuracy, invoice exception volume, integration error rates and user support trends.
- Transition from hypercare to continuous improvement only after process stability and control effectiveness are demonstrated.
Which governance model supports long-term ROI and enterprise resilience
Business ROI in quote-to-revenue programs comes from fewer manual interventions, faster cycle times, cleaner billing, stronger renewal readiness and better management visibility. Those outcomes depend on governance after go-live as much as during implementation. Executive governance should continue through a design authority or ERP council that reviews enhancement requests, release priorities, control exceptions, integration changes and data quality trends. This prevents the platform from drifting back into fragmented operations.
Risk management and business continuity should be embedded in the operating model. That includes backup and recovery testing, dependency mapping for critical integrations, monitoring and observability for application and infrastructure health, and documented ownership for incident response. For organizations operating across multiple legal entities or regions, multi-company management should be governed through shared standards with local control only where justified by tax, regulatory or operational differences. AI-assisted implementation opportunities are growing, but they should be applied selectively. AI can accelerate process documentation, test case generation, anomaly detection in migrated data, support ticket triage and workflow automation design. It can also improve analytics by surfacing billing exceptions, renewal risk indicators or approval bottlenecks. However, governance should require human validation for policy, financial and security decisions. Future trends will likely include more event-driven integrations, stronger embedded analytics, broader workflow automation and tighter alignment between ERP, customer success and revenue operations. The organizations that benefit most will be those that treat governance as a strategic capability rather than a project artifact.
